I have been working on my Mini quite a bit lately - In the last 45 days:
New wheels and tires - lightweight 17x8 wheels and 235-40/17 UHP tires
Alta Sway Bar
FMIC
Still to go in:
3" cat delete downpipe
2.5" straight pipe exhaust
turbo that doesn't spew oil - stock bad turbo will get sent out to be rebuilt as K03/K04 hybrid. This was the plan, but my turbo has recently decided to spew lots and lots of oil.
DIY water/meth kit - this has been in process for a while, mostly because finding the right fittings are a PITA.
In looking at where to mount the injection nozzle, I came up with an idea - mount the nozzle into a plug that deletes the noisemaker. I think it should work out perfect - the pump and solenoid will be on the firewall just to the drivers side of my AEM intake - nice and short shot to the nozzle. Using factory washer bottle for fluid.

On the N14 isn’t the MAP sensor in the intake manifold? Noisemaker is upstream of that so putting meth nozzle in noisemaker delete plug should work, right?
I have never ever touched my MAP sensor but thought it was in the intake itself.

They are all technically MAP sensors !
One is a manifold sensor
The other is a boost sensor
You need the nozzle before the boost sensor ‘ just like the photo I posted’ check out aquamist install kit guide ‘

The sensor on the manifold measures manifold vacuum/pressure. The sensor on the intake pipe, near the fender liner, measures both boost and temperature, that's why the WMI should be before the 1st sensor --- to sense the WMI cooling and make appropriate ECU adjustments.
